A church father on this verse
"Wilt thou show wonders to the dead?" Not to those who, living, are dead, but to me who live in thee. "Or shall physicians raise them up?" and the rest. Not the spices of physicians, but thou, Father, raisest me up; nor they, but I will confess among the peoples.
Jerome, 5th c. — Homily 65, on Psalm 87 (Alternate Series)
